The document contains tables summarizing the results of an image classification experiment with different lighting conditions and orientations. It reports the number of correct detections and average confidence levels for classes of Coke, Del Monte, and others at different camera distances and bulb wattages. The highest average confidence levels were close to 0.99 and the lowest were around 0.90, with some variation depending on the specific class, orientation, distance and lighting conditions.
